Globe is an unincorporated community in Lane County, in the U.S. state of Oregon.[1] Globe lies along Oregon Route 126 between Walton and Austa in the Central Oregon Coast Range east of Florence. Wildcat Creek, a tributary of the Siuslaw River, flows by Globe. One of the creek's tributaries, Pataha Creek, enters the larger stream at Globe.[2]
